Edging is the practice of developing clean, defined boundaries in between various landscape elements, such as yards, garden beds, pathways, and patio areas. Proper edging boosts the visual appeal of a property, prevents yard from intruding into flower beds, and makes maintenance tasks like mowing much easier and more precise. Techniques include setting up physical barriers like metal, plastic, or stone edging, in addition to forming soil or grass to develop natural borders. Material choice and installation methods vary depending upon the desired visual, landscape style, and long-term resilience. Routine upkeep of edges avoids overgrowth, maintains crisp lines, and contributes to a refined, intentional look. Effective edging is both a practical tool and a style component, improving the overall organization and beauty of a landscape
